ServiceNow

Senior Staff Software Engineer - (Backend C++)

Join ServiceNow as a Senior Staff Software Engineer in California. Leverage C/C++ skills to enhance RaptorDB, focusing on scalable solutions. Benefits include health plans and stock options.

ServiceNow Role Type:
ServiceNow Modules:
No items found.
ServiceNow Certifications (nice to have):

Job description

Date - JobBoardly X Webflow Template
Posted on:
 
October 8, 2025

ServiceNow is seeking an experienced Senior Staff Software Engineer with C/C++ knowledge to contribute to the development of its foundational database platform, RaptorDB. The role involves collaborating with teams, analyzing performance, and building scalable software solutions. This is an opportunity to work with state-of-the-art open-source technologies in a fast-paced environment.

Requirements

  • In-depth knowledge of computer and general systems architecture
  • Excellent skills in object-oriented programming combined with some C/C++ and SQL
  • Experience in test-driven development
  • Solid understanding and experience with agile software development methodologies
  • Strong problem-solving and analytical skills

Benefits

  • Health plans
  • 401(k) Plan
  • Employee stock options
  • Flexible spending accounts
  • Flexible time away plan
  • Family leave programs

Requirements Summary

10+ years of software development experience. C/C++ and SQL knowledge are essential. Strong analytical and problem-solving skills are crucial